Title: Authorizing the sole source purchase of services contract with Controlworks for low voltage HVAC controls for the installation and programming of a new building automation system at Warner Park Community Recreation Center and Amending the 2017 Adopted Capital Budget to transfer $10,000 of existing GO borrowing budget authority from the Engineering-Facility Management's Sustainability Imrovements capital program to Parks Division's Park Facility Improvements capital program.
Sponsors: Larry Palm, David Ahrens

Fiscal Note

The proposed resolution authorizes the sole source contract for the Warner Park Community Center building automation system at a cost of $37,519 which will be funded by GO borrowing within the Parks Division’s Park Facility Improvements Capital Program.  The proposed resolution also authorizes an amendment to the adopted 2017 capital budget for a net-neutral transfer of $10,000 of GO borrowing funding from Engineering-Facility Management’s Sustainability Program (MUNIS 10563) to the Park’s Divisions Facility Improvements capital program to provide for the costs of the energy efficient components of the project within the contract.

 

In the adopted 2017 capital budget Engineering-Facilities management has budgeted $750,000 of GO borrowing to support the implementation of the Madison Sustainability Plan via solar and energy efficient installations throughout the City via the Sustainability Improvements capital program (MUNIS 10563). There is sufficient budget authority available within the program to allow for the transfer of $10,000 of GO budget authority from the Sustainability Improvement program to the Park Divisions’ Facility Improvements if adopted.

Title

Authorizing the sole source purchase of services contract with Controlworks for low voltage HVAC controls for the installation and programming of a new building automation system at Warner Park Community Recreation Center and Amending the 2017 Adopted Capital Budget to transfer $10,000 of existing GO borrowing budget authority from the Engineering-Facility Management's Sustainability Imrovements capital program to Parks Division's Park Facility Improvements capital program.

Body

WHEREAS, Parks budget includes $35,000 for a new building automation system at Warner Park Community Recreation Center and the actual cost is $37,519 because several components were added to make the system more energy efficient. In addition some engineering staff time is required to verify the system is configured optimally. The difference will be covered by a transfer from the Engineering-Sustainability Improvements project. The revised total project budget is $45,000.

 

WHEREAS, our building automation system protocol is standardized on Honeywell; and

 

WHEREAS, our building automation systems are networked together and maintained at a central location; and

 

WHEREAS Controlworks is the only authorized Honeywell vendor in the Madison area; and,

 

WHEREAS Controlworks has completed over 30 system installations at most of our large facilities; and,

 

WHEREAS using another product line other than Honeywell or another vendor other than Controlworks could create inefficiencies in our maintenance processes or higher utility bills; and,

 

WHEREAS, under MGO 4.26(4)(b), if a service contract exceeds $25,000 and the contract was not subject to a competitive selection process, the contract shall meet one of the requirements of sec. 4.26(4)(a) and be approved by the Common Council, and signed by the Mayor and Clerk; and

 

WHEREAS, this contract meets section 4.26(4)(a)7 which provides that a contract may be approved without a competitive selection process if the contractor has performed similar services in the past and it would be economical on the basis of time and money to retain the same firm.

 

NOW, THEREFORE BE IT RESOLVED that the Mayor and City Clerk are hereby authorized to enter into a contract with Controlworks to provide for low voltage HVAC controls for the installation and programming of a new building automation system at Warner Park Community Recreation Center; and,

 

BE IT FURTHER RESOLVED that in accordance with MGO section 4.26(4)(a)7 the Common Council finds that the further solicitation of proposals is not required because the contractor has performed similar services in the past and it would be economical on the basis of time and money to retain the same firm.

 

BE IT FINALLY RESOLVED that the 2017 Engineering-Facilities Management and Parks Division capital budgets are hereby amended to transfer $10,000 of general obligation borrowing funding from the Sustainability Improvements major project to the Park Facility Improvements (Parks Division) major project.
